Milwaukee, Wis. —News radio 620 WTMJ will again lead the annual Teddy Bear Patrol campaign, sponsored by Water Stone Bank and All American Window & Door. Since 1993, the Teddy Bear Patrol campaign has collected and distributed 95,000 new teddy bears to local law enforcement and fire officials. These officials give the bears to children who are faced with crisis (abuse, neglect, fire, accidents, etc.) to help comfort them in traumatic situations.
